Put up that point
Significato di Put up that point
To state or present a specific idea or argument.
In simple words: to state or suggest an idea or opinion
Put up that point in una frase
- During the meeting, she decided to put up that point about budget cuts.
- Let's put up that point for discussion in our next session.
- He put up that point, which changed everyone's opinion.
Come usare Put up that point
Used in discussions or debates to introduce a specific point. More common in formal settings; less so in casual conversations.
Grammar pattern
put up + that + noun
